False Laser Alerts in BMW

Turning the gesture control "off" in the car does not turn of the lasers for the gesture control camera. Those remain on.

You have 3 options to stop false laser alerts inside the newer BMWs.

1)Small piece of electrical tape on the little red circle between the bogey counter window and the radar band indicator lights.
2)Completely tape up the gesture control cameras in the overhead console with electrical tape
3)Disable Laser detection on the radar detector.

2019 BMW X5 with Valentine1 radar detector

After installing my Valentine 1 radar detector on the windshield the radar immediately triggered Laser alarm from rear, all LED on, 3 dashes on.
Per my phone call with Valentine technical support this issue is caused by "Gesture control system" which operates on same laser frequency as police laser radar.

According to Valentine 1 technical support only way to fix it is to cover the Gesture control system sensor (I do not know where it is). There is no way to disable it.

So...I decide to experiment. I cut about 1/4 inch circle from electrical tape and glue it on the front of my Valentine detector on the red display screen where you see dark red circle.

The laser alarm immediately stopped. I think this solution decrease or completely disabled the laser sensitivity from rear which I can live without it.

I am in process testing if the front laser sensor is still working.

My next experiment will be to replace the electrical tape circle with 1/4 inch circle tubing length about 1/2 inch around the Lase sensor. Maybe the tubing will shield the noise from Gesture control system and still aloud to pass the laser signal through tubing/sleeve and the rear laser will still work without interference.(Tip:I am going to use black rubber sleeve from the pen).

I hope this may help to all Valentine 1 users.
